The town first hosted an NBA workforce in the course of the 2005-06 season, when the New Orleans Hornets briefly relocated after Hurricane Katrina. Oklahoma Metropolis’s followers fell in love with the workforce and a younger level guard named Chris Paul who could be named rookie of the 12 months.
The Seattle SuperSonics relocated to Oklahoma Metropolis in time for the 2008-09 season, and followers feverishly supported the workforce, regardless of its early struggles. The Thunder turned contenders with younger stars Kevin Durant, Russell Westbrook and James Harden.
Even with all that expertise, they could not break by. They misplaced to the Miami Warmth within the NBA Finals in 2012, and Harden left for Houston. A potential run in 2013 was derailed when Westbrook was injured in the course of the playoffs. The 2015-16 workforce led the Golden State Warriors 3-1 within the Western Convention finals earlier than dropping the collection in seven video games.
Durant left to hitch the Warriors after that season, ending that model of the Thunder. Westbrook was the league MVP in 2017 and averaged a triple-double for 3 straight seasons, however the Thunder by no means received out of the primary spherical these years.

Tv audiences definitely observed. Oklahoma Metropolis’s 103-91 victory over Indiana in Recreation 7 was the most-watched NBA Finals recreation in six years.
Sunday evening’s recreation averaged 16.53 million on ABC and ESPN+ in accordance with preliminary scores information from Nielsen. The viewers peaked at 19.28 million in the course of the second half (9:45-10 p.m. EDT).
It’s the first time since Toronto wrapped up its title in Recreation 6 in opposition to Golden State in 2019 (18.34 million) that the finals have had an viewers over 16 million. The final Recreation 7, when Cleveland beat Golden State in 2016, averaged 31.02 million.
The seven-game collection averaged 10.27 million, down from the 11.31 million common for Boston’s victory over Dallas in 5 video games final 12 months.
The seven video games had been the most-watched tv broadcasts because the first week of Might.
ESPN and ABC averaged 6.12 million for the 34 video games they carried in the course of the playoffs, a 10-percent enhance over final 12 months.

The Thunder’s brilliant future is, partially, a product of the workforce’s youth.
Energy ahead Chet Holmgren continues to be simply 23, whereas Jalen Williams is a 12 months older, Canadian stars Shai Gilgeous-Alexander and Luguentz Dort are solely 26, and combo guard Cason Wallace is simply 21.
There’s even a 19-year-old in Nikola Subject, who missed the 2024-25 season because of damage however nonetheless turned the primary participant to win an NBA title earlier than logging a minute within the league.
